2.4.4 Actuating time
The time required for the spindle nut to travel a defined distance is called
actuating time. Actuating time is specified in s/mm. Encoding switch S4 is used
to set the actuating time.

2.4.5 Hysteresis
Hysteresis equals the difference of the input signal (Y) that is required after a
reversal of signal direction in order to move the spindle nut.
It serves to prevent permanent oscillation of the actuator motor around a certain
hoisting position during minor input signal alterations.

2.4.6 Manual mode and response signal
In manual mode it is possible to change the lift without supply voltage.
• Motor and control electronics are turned off in manual mode to make hoisting
movements of the control impossible.
• The moment you set the linear actuator to manual mode the control switches
a signal to terminal R, provided supply voltage is applied.

2.4.7 Auto test
If a valve is not actuated for a long time the valve cone may get stuck. The auto
test function acts as a preventative measure. When you turn on the auto test
function for the linear actuator, the linear actuator will automatically move after
c. 10 days without actuation to the limit position set by encoding switch S6 and
return to initial position.

2.4.8 Auto pause
This function is used by the actuator to count the traverse commands per minute
that involve a change of direction. If there are more than 20 direction varying
traverse commands per minute this will result in a compulsory pause of 3 s.

2.4.9 Potential-free limit switch (accessory)
The optional path switch PCB allows you (106) to set two actuating positions
within which a potential-free contact is opened or closed.
